在HTML中,onclick
是一个事件处理程序,用于在用户点击元素时执行JavaScript代码。REST(Representational State Transfer)请求是一种用于访问和操作Web资源的架构风格。通过JavaScript发起REST请求,通常使用XMLHttpRequest
对象或现代的fetch
API。
以下是一个使用JavaScript在HTML onclick
事件上发起REST请求的示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>REST Request Example</title>
</head>
<body>
<button id="myButton">Click Me</button>
<script>
document.getElementById('myButton').onclick = function() {
fetch('https://api.example.com/data', {
method: 'GET',
headers: {
'Content-Type': 'application/json'
}
})
.then(response => response.json())
.then(data => {
console.log('Success:', data);
})
.catch((error) => {
console.error('Error:', error);
});
};
</script>
</body>
</html>
通过以上信息,你应该能够理解如何在HTML onclick
事件上使用JavaScript发起REST请求,并解决一些常见问题。
腾讯云GAME-TECH游戏开发者技术沙龙
云+社区技术沙龙[第5期]
北极星训练营
腾讯云GAME-TECH游戏开发者技术沙龙
云原生正发声
云+社区技术沙龙[第14期]
TC-Day
TC-Day
云+社区技术沙龙[第8期]
北极星训练营
领取专属 10元无门槛券
手把手带您无忧上云